

Founders Park is a tidy community park with a small pond, fountain, mature trees, a gazebo/pavilion and sweeping views toward nearby foothills and the Great Salt Lake—good for reflections, seasonal foliage and calm sunset skies. Easy public access with free parking, paved paths and wheelchair-friendly areas. Best at golden hour or blue hour for lake reflections and mountain silhouettes; weekdays or early mornings avoid families and events.
